They're a pork product that is low in fat, so you're looking at around 15 grams of fat per 1 pound of chitterlings.Before you even begin to clean chitterlings, the CDC recommends boiling them for five minutes to protect yourself from harmful contaminants. To clean them, you'll need vinegar or baking soda, in which you'll soak them after rinsing them off. You should rinse them again after slicing them in half and continue until the water turns clear.

Jul 18, 2023 · Once the chitterlings are clean, place them in a large pot and cover them with water. Add the onion, salt, garlic, and red pepper flakes to the pot and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er for 3 hours or until tender. Make sure to check the water level periodically and add more if needed.

Make sure the water is cold as warm water can easily allow bacteria growth.There are three safe ways to thaw food: in the refrigerator, in cold water, and in the microwave. Foods thawed by the cold water method or in the microwave should be cooked immediately after thawing. For raw, uncooked meat, the USDA recommends that ground meats be kept at 40 degrees or less, whole cuts of meat be kept at 41 degrees or less ...Use your raw chitterlings within two days of thawing. Use frozen chitterlings within 3 to 4 months.
